Developmental Mechanisms Problem Set 
Problem 1: Definition of a homeotic gene
Homeotic genes:
 
| A. | Determine the developmental fate of groups of cells in segments of an
       organism 
       Pattern formation is essential to the development of all organisms. Once the basic pattern of a developing organism has been established, homeotic genes tell each segment what to develop into.
